Peter M. Haas (born January 23, 1955) is a professor of Political Science at theUniversity of Massachusetts Amherst[1] and the Karl Deutsch Visiting Professor at theWissenschaftszentrum Berlin.[2]

His research concernsepistemic communities, global environmental politics, multilevel governance, and the role of science in global politics.[3]

Haas received his undergraduate education from theUniversity of Michigan[3] and his Ph.D. in 1986 from theMassachusetts Institute of Technology.[1][3] He has been at Amherst since 1987, and has held visiting positions atYale University,Brown University, andOxford University.[4] His father,Ernst B. Haas, was also a notable political scientist.[3]

Haas was a co-founder of theEarth System Governance Project in 2009.[5]
